A:AnswerHi Sulia- "Garage ready" means the freezer has been tested to perform from 0°F to 110°F and suitable for garage installation. It is not designed for outdoor use (exposed to outdoor elements). It should be placed in a dry, well ventilated room. Keep in touch! SUE@GEA

A:AnswerHi PHbird- FCM5SKWW has (1) Slide-Out, Wire Storage Basket and FCM7SKWW has (2) Slide-Out, Wire Storage Baskets. FCM5SKWW is 28 3/4" wide and FCM7SKWW is 37 1/4" wide. Thanks for choosing GE! SUE@GEA

A:AnswerHi Dan- Thanks for considering our GE® Chest Freezer FCM5SKWW! The freezer is 28 3/4" wide x 21 1/4" deep. Allow 3" air clearance on sides and back of freezer. Keep in touch! SUE@GEA
